Posted: Mon Mar 29, 2004 11:16 pm
by IndianaGuybrush
Black goes with everything, although many people feel that black isn't good for brown and/or navy blue...
Regardless, I kind of had the same problem. I think it was less of a problem of the shoes actually going with what I was wearing, and more of a problem of me not really digging the brickness of the boots. I know it's leagues better than the pumpkin that people had to deal with, but they're new and I'm still getting usedk to them. One thing I found that helped me, I darkened them. I don't know if this was ill advised or not, so take this with a grain of salt. I used brown and black (very little black) kiwi shoe polish to darken them to a much deeper brown, and then kind of sealed that in with Pecard's boot oil. This darkened the shoes a lot, but left a really nice mahogany color, in other words, a deep brown without sacrificing that beatiful red undertone. Now I think they're hot. But I don't know if you want to do that to your $260+ shoes.

Posted: Tue Mar 30, 2004 2:39 am
by JohnNdy
I used acetone on them to strip the sealer and color and then redyed them to a beautiful medium brown. I know most people aren't willing to do this with such an expensive pair of shoes - but it makes a whole WORLD of difference in terms of what they go with. A nice pair of true brown shoes goes with most anything...
